scala vs clojure ?# Programming - 葵花宝典c*d2017-03-15 07:031 楼本人非faculty。是否要尽快找faculty位置?感觉做高级postdoc,没什么太多感觉。现在这里,文章发的也很慢。又了解行情的,说一下。
j*n2017-03-15 07:032 楼【 以下文字转载自 Visa 讨论区 】发信人: jacobn (金箍棒), 信区: Visa标 题: 三个中信代签问题发信站: BBS 未名空间站 (Sun Aug 19 15:36:44 2012, 美东)1、计划明年4月赴美,现在可以网上提交DS150表格并打印确认页,然后到明年年初再去中信银行办理申请手续么?也就是说,从提交表格到去中信办理,再到赴美,有没有除了签证/护照有效期以外的时间上的限制?2、现在代签都由广州处理,而我上次是在上海面签,那么在美领馆网上能复用上次的表格吗?我知道可以先选择地点广州再调出以前在上海用的表格,但不知道这样能否真正把地点从上海改到广州?3、关于照片,美领馆网站上的说法是最近6个月之内或者能反映近期面貌的,那么是否意味着如果没有什么变化可以使用1年前的照片?
g*t2017-03-15 07:034 楼hci, scala的functional programming也不错啊?Any comments?另外我和wdong看法类似。先不说Java,scala能走llvm就走llvm,我觉得这是目前语言的王道。加一分
a*92017-03-15 07:035 楼能否找到职位, 和你的实力, 时机和运气有关. 你能找到合适的职位, 当然还是自己独立的好, 和"是否尽快"没有什么关系. Co-PI的grant, 作用很有限, 大家一般认为Co-PI接近于"打酱油"的; 而且你离开的时候多半也带不走钱(PI说了算).
w*t2017-03-15 07:036 楼DS150是神码?【 以下文字转载自 Visa 讨论区 】发信人: jacobn (金箍棒), 信区: Visa标★ Sent from iPhone App: iReader Mitbbs Lite 7.56【在 j****n 的大作中提到】: 【 以下文字转载自 Visa 讨论区 】: 发信人: jacobn (金箍棒), 信区: Visa: 标 题: 三个中信代签问题: 发信站: BBS 未名空间站 (Sun Aug 19 15:36:44 2012, 美东): 1、计划明年4月赴美,现在可以网上提交DS150表格并打印确认页,然后到明年年初再: 去中信银行办理申请手续么?也就是说,从提交表格到去中信办理,再到赴美,有没有: 除了签证/护照有效期以外的时间上的限制?: 2、现在代签都由广州处理,而我上次是在上海面签,那么在美领馆网上能复用上次的: 表格吗?我知道可以先选择地点广州再调出以前在上海用的表格,但不知道这样能否真: 正把地点从上海改到广州?
s*e2017-03-15 07:037 楼好听啊!声音清晰柔美,歌词也美。那个时代作品真的好。【在 t****7 的大作中提到】: 最近对香港70/80年代的老片感兴趣。这是刘松仁,韩马利《陆小凤》中的插曲,堪称: 极品!
h*i2017-03-15 07:0311 楼我对Scala没研究过,但从一些人的评论来看,Scala是一种很复杂的语言,OOP, FP,什么都想要,所以不是我的菜,没有一丁点的兴趣。这是个口味问题,当年我面临C++和Java的选择,我选了Java。所以Scala与Clojure,必然是选Clojure啊。也有人在搞llvm上的Clojure【在 g****t 的大作中提到】: hci, scala的functional programming也不错啊?: Any comments?: 另外我和wdong看法类似。: 先不说Java,scala能走llvm就走llvm,我觉得这是目前语言的王道。: 加一分
g*t2017-03-15 07:0314 楼python走llvm,难点之一是C扩展的各种库搞不定。llvm上的clojure是不是也会有这个问题?【在 h*i 的大作中提到】: 我对Scala没研究过,但从一些人的评论来看,Scala是一种很复杂的语言,OOP, FP,: 什么都想要,所以不是我的菜,没有一丁点的兴趣。这是个口味问题,当年我面临C++: 和Java的选择,我选了Java。所以Scala与Clojure,必然是选Clojure啊。: 也有人在搞llvm上的Clojure
a*92017-03-15 07:0315 楼大家都是圈子里的人, 知道grant申请是怎么回事. 越是这种大的grant, 越是大老板的背景起作用, 其他人更是打酱油的.你把这个列到CV里, 对一个博士后来说, 当然只有好处没有坏处, 告诉别人你有个牛老板, 潜在的"关系网"可能不错. 当然, "好处"肯定是很有限的.把自己的publication加强, 有合适的机会就去试. 博士后拿到独立grant的机会不大(除非是research track faculty, 而且有些年头了), 所以不用在这上面想的太多.【在 c***d 的大作中提到】: 谢谢回复。: 本来以为好几个million的大grant,有帮助。: preliminary data搞了俺整一年。: 看来是过度期待了,只能要求加工资这点好处了。
h*i2017-03-15 07:0316 楼据搞过的人说,在其他VM上搞Clojure, 主要问题其实不是扩展库的问题,而是Garbage Collection都不够好,Clojure的缺省immutable数据对GC的要求非常高。这方面,JVM的GC是目前无敌的。【在 g****t 的大作中提到】: python走llvm,难点之一是C扩展的各种库搞不定。: llvm上的clojure是不是也会有这个问题?
x*42017-03-15 07:0317 楼我也很想试试Clojure。不过我1)很害怕很多括号;2)很害怕没有static typing。有什么解法吗?【在 h*i 的大作中提到】: 我对Scala没研究过,但从一些人的评论来看,Scala是一种很复杂的语言,OOP, FP,: 什么都想要,所以不是我的菜,没有一丁点的兴趣。这是个口味问题,当年我面临C++: 和Java的选择,我选了Java。所以Scala与Clojure,必然是选Clojure啊。: 也有人在搞llvm上的Clojure
h*i2017-03-15 07:0318 楼1) Clojure的括号比Java要少,无非是括的地方不同而已。2)为啥害怕没有static typing?你是用haskell这种的的么?否则有啥区别?【在 x***4 的大作中提到】: 我也很想试试Clojure。不过我1)很害怕很多括号;2)很害怕没有static typing。有: 什么解法吗?
O*b2017-03-15 07:0319 楼写 web 绝大多数都是字符串转来转去,没有 typing 不是特别大的隐患。Clojure 的accidental complexity 我认为是要小很多的。
h*i2017-03-15 07:0320 楼对。Clojure目前主要的用途就是用来写Web,前后端都可以用,代码清爽,简单明了,几乎没有什么缺陷。的【在 O***b 的大作中提到】: 写 web 绝大多数都是字符串转来转去,没有 typing 不是特别大的隐患。Clojure 的: accidental complexity 我认为是要小很多的。
n*72017-03-15 07:0321 楼我本来是跟你观点差不多的不过前两天看了知乎著名ID 韦一笑对scala的评论,觉得也有道理:OOP和FP都有自己合适和不太合适的方面所以什么合适的地方用什么,这实际上也是一种化繁为简如果为了形式上的简美,有的时候得削足适履,似乎也不上算需要说他也放弃了C++,因为他认为C++的设计有根本上的逻辑矛盾我也觉得很有道理。。。【在 h*i 的大作中提到】: 我对Scala没研究过,但从一些人的评论来看,Scala是一种很复杂的语言,OOP, FP,: 什么都想要,所以不是我的菜,没有一丁点的兴趣。这是个口味问题,当年我面临C++: 和Java的选择,我选了Java。所以Scala与Clojure,必然是选Clojure啊。: 也有人在搞llvm上的Clojure
k*i2017-03-15 07:0322 楼两个套路基于JVM/V8 runtime之类的利用JIT+GC而LLVM是用AOTGC类语言要自己实现runtime现在server端的scala转LLVM与client端的asmjs转WASM性能或会提高坑还是很多【在 g****t 的大作中提到】: hci, scala的functional programming也不错啊?: Any comments?: 另外我和wdong看法类似。: 先不说Java,scala能走llvm就走llvm,我觉得这是目前语言的王道。: 加一分
d*n2017-03-15 07:0323 楼如果去纯scala的公司,例如confluent或者databricks,其实是很开心的。但是如果你周围都是学java出身的程序员,觉得scala可以和java混着用,用scala其实是劣势。搞不好比纯java还糟糕。写得烂的scala程序不仅效率低下而且难读无比,找bug也比java花的时间多。所以除非你做到architect或者manager能做到帮程序员做工具选择的地步,否则要么不要碰scala,要么做开源项目的ic算了。【在 h*i 的大作中提到】: 我对Scala没研究过,但从一些人的评论来看,Scala是一种很复杂的语言,OOP, FP,: 什么都想要,所以不是我的菜,没有一丁点的兴趣。这是个口味问题,当年我面临C++: 和Java的选择,我选了Java。所以Scala与Clojure,必然是选Clojure啊。: 也有人在搞llvm上的Clojure
N*m2017-03-15 07:0324 楼confluent不是纯scala了,Kafka新的code都是java【在 d****n 的大作中提到】: 如果去纯scala的公司,例如confluent或者databricks,其实是很开心的。: 但是如果你周围都是学java出身的程序员,觉得scala可以和java混着用,用scala其实: 是劣势。搞不好比纯java还糟糕。写得烂的scala程序不仅效率低下而且难读无比,找: bug也比java花的时间多。: 所以除非你做到architect或者manager能做到帮程序员做工具选择的地步,否则要么不: 要碰scala,要么做开源项目的ic算了。
g*t2017-03-15 07:0325 楼hci老师我就不说客气话了。感谢楼里好各位的回帖。有价值的内容非常多。【在 g****t 的大作中提到】: hci, scala的functional programming也不错啊?: Any comments?: 另外我和wdong看法类似。: 先不说Java,scala能走llvm就走llvm,我觉得这是目前语言的王道。: 加一分
d*n2017-03-15 07:0326 楼我也不懂scala为啥老转型,原先叫typesafe,后来叫lightbend,现在又想搞编译器?【在 N*****m 的大作中提到】: confluent不是纯scala了,Kafka新的code都是java
m*o2017-03-15 07:0327 楼为啥一定要上llvm?Scala + Zing如何?【在 g****t 的大作中提到】: hci, scala的functional programming也不错啊?: Any comments?: 另外我和wdong看法类似。: 先不说Java,scala能走llvm就走llvm,我觉得这是目前语言的王道。: 加一分